Responsibilities
- The role will be a hybrid role based in any of the following locations: Arlington, Chicago, San Francisco, Los Angeles, Newark, Dallas.
- What you can expect
- Provide support to origination staff on Agency requirements and deal structuring; initial point of contact for origination staff for Agency transactions.
- Primary liaison between PGIM and Agency production and credit staff with input, as necessary from PGIM 's Chief and/or Deputy Chief Underwriter on unique deal structures and/or underwriting exceptions.
- Possess and apply thorough knowledge of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ac policies and procedures.
- Size, Structure and Price individual transactions for origination staff to win new business.
- Prepare, review and submit quality quote requests to Agencies within 24 - 48 hours of screening, with support from assigned Analysts. Assess issues and provide intelligent risk-based solutions aligned with PGIM and Agency program requirements and guidelines.
- Coordinate between origination and Credit/Chief Underwriter when structuring issues arise at origination.
- Provide full and timely disclosure of known transaction risks to ensure open communication among all team members during initial screening process.
- Review Agency response letters for accuracy.
- Prepare Loan Applications for signature and negotiate approved changes in coordination with legal.
- Responsible for handoff from Origination to Underwriting.
- Manage analytical staff assignments to assure timing expectations met and accuracy of information.
- Mentor of Deal Manager/Origination Associates and Analysts, as appropriate.
